Security forces killed 27 terrorists in operations conducted in the Miran Shah area of Khyber Pakhtunkhwa’s North Waziristan district over the past 72 hours, the military’s media affairs wing said on Sunday.
“In continuation of a series of intelligence-based operations, security Forces engaged multiple khawarij locations in the general area Miran Shah, North Waziristan District,” the Inter-Services Public Relations (ISPR) said in a statement.
It added that after “fierce exchanges of fire” 27 terrorists belonging to “India-sponsored Fitna al Khawarij were sent to hell”.
Fitna al Khawarij is a term that the state uses for the banned Tehreek-i-Taliban Pakistan (TTP).
